Creative Urban Garden Ideas + Herb Wall

Urban gardening is a fantastic way to bring greenery and life to city spaces. Whether you have a balcony, rooftop, or even just a small patio, there are endless possibilities to create a lush urban oasis. One creative and space-saving idea for urban gardening is to build an herb wall.
Herb Wall
An herb wall is a vertical garden structure that allows you to grow herbs in a compact and visually appealing way. It not only adds a touch of green to your urban space but also provides fresh herbs for cooking right at your fingertips.
How to Create an Herb Wall:
- Select a Wall: Choose a sunny wall or fence where your herbs will receive adequate sunlight.
- Vertical Planters: Use vertical planters or hanging pots to plant your herbs. Make sure they have good drainage.
- Herb Selection: Choose a variety of herbs such as basil, mint, rosemary, and thyme that thrive in your climate.
- Planting: Plant your herbs in the vertical planters, ensuring they have enough space to grow and spread their roots.
- Maintenance: Regularly water and fertilize your herbs, and trim them as needed to promote healthy growth.
Benefits of an Herb Wall:
- Space-Saving: Ideal for small urban spaces where horizontal space is limited.
- Easy Access: Harvest fresh herbs without having to bend or search through a garden bed.
- Visual Appeal: Adds a decorative and aromatic element to your outdoor area.
- Sustainability: Grow your own herbs organically, reducing the need for store-bought herbs.
